opinions on 07 raptor 700?
Thinking of getting a 2007 raptor 700 . Just curious of opinions on the bike compared too other race quads? I'm 115 pounds I know the bikes got power, I was told there were issues with the front end lifting going to fast
|
They are a great ride. A little heavy but a lot of torque. I don't think the front is uncontrollable, maybe just don't use so much throttle, lol. The 700 has a soft riding suspension, I just prefer a little lower seating position and better handling personally. Having said that, I could certainly be happy with a 700 at this point in my life.

I like the 700 vs the 450s racers, they make the same hp and more low end grunt but unlike the 450s who make 45hp with high rpm the 700 makes 45hp lazily. Tell me which one will need a rebuild first down the road.
